EDP integrates all generation and supply operations in Brazil reinforcing its competitiveness in free market
Lisbon, May 19th, 2026: EDP, S.A. (“EDP”), has decided to integrate its electricity generation, trading and supply operations in Brazil under its fully owned subsidiary EDP - Energias do Brasil S.A. (“EDP Brasil”). As a result, an agreement has been reached for the acquisition, by EDP Brasil, of 100% of EDP Renováveis Brasil (“EDPR Brasil”), which is currently a subsidiary of EDP Renewables, S.A. (“EDPR”). EDPR is a listed subsidiary of EDP, with a 28.7% free float.
EDPR Brasil operates an installed capacity of 1.8 GW (1.1 GW wind onshore and 0.7 GW solar utility scale). The further integration of EDP Group’s generation, trading and supply to clients in Brazil under EDP Brasil reinforces EDP’s agility, competitiveness and risk management in the Brazilian free electricity market, which is going through dynamic developments with gradual liberalization of the small and medium enterprises and retail segments. Moreover, it supports the focus on operating and financial efficiency within the Group.
The equity value of EDPR Brasil in the transaction is c.R$4.1 billion (c.€0.7 billion, considering a 6.0 EUR/BRL exchange rate), subject to customary adjustments until closing, targeted by year-end 2026, while the implied enterprise value amounts to c.€1.5 billion. The transaction price and terms were agreed at arm’s length, being supported by fairness opinions from independent financial advisors. The transaction was subject to the applicable internal procedures and obtained the approvals of the competent corporate bodies, taking into account, in particular, the fact that it constitutes a related-party transaction.
This transaction is fully aligned with the execution of EDP’s 2026-2028 Business Plan and the associated financial targets.
